Caracteristics

 

• The temple has the most remarkable setting of all the natural sites in Cambodia
• Perched high on a cliff edge of the Dangrek Escarpment overlooking Cambodia some 600 metres below.

Comments
 

 

 

• Located in the northern most tip of Cambodia this temple was not accessible until October 2003.
• Still difficult to reach, Preah Vihear is the most impressive one even after having seen all the majors Khmer temples. The giant nagas are the eternel gardians of this magic place.
